To truly appreciate the song, it's essential to understand its origins. "Tera Mujhse Hai Pehle Ka Naata Koi" (तेरा मुझसे है पहले का नाता कोई), which translates to "We have a connection from a past life," is a classic duet from the 1973 Hindi film Aa Gale Lag Jaa (Come, Embrace Me).

The iconic track remains one of Indian cinema’s most enduring melodies. Originally composed by the legendary R.D. Burman with lyrics by Sahir Ludhianvi for the 1973 film Aa Gale Lag Jaa , the track has transcended generations.
